sigh
09-01-2007, 09:06 PM
I used to use pinnacle, but now I need a new site for the new football season. I'm looking to deposit about 10k. Whats the easiest way I can do that nowadays. Without neteller, what do I use? And what sites are the most reliable? Thank you for anyones help